In the wake of recent earthquakes in Chile and Haiti, Melissa Block of All Things Considered interviewed CEE Professor Eduardo Kausel, a native Chilean who began studying earthquakes after the Great Chilean Earthquake of 1960. Kausel and Block talked about how strict building codes help safeguard both people and buildings. The interview aired Monday on NPR. Listen at NPR.org.
